Fireside at Apteds is a grant-funded evening created specifically for local farmers, growers, primary producers, farm workers and farming families.
Join us at Apteds Orchards for a generous seasonal dinner prepared by Hot Coals Catering, live acoustic music and a relaxed evening around the fire.
Farming and growing can be rewarding, but it can also be demanding and isolating. This evening is an opportunity to step away from the workload, enjoy genuinely good food and connect with others who understand agricultural life in our region.
There won’t be lengthy presentations or formal workshops. Relevant farmer wellbeing and support services will be available for brief introductions, informal conversations and discreet access to helpful resources.
Arrive while there’s still daylight to enjoy the orchard in blossom before settling in for dinner.
